Nothing that would pass deep scrutiny. Just our experience running SSDs in almost every server at Stack. We've only had one mass failure of drives. That was when 5/8 Samsung drives died around the same time in our packet capture box. The remaining 3 are still alive, although we don't really use them.

We have only had two Intel drives die on us. I'm interested (well academically, not professionally) if they will die at the same time or keep dropping off one at a time.

We tend to retire the machines or the drives in them before they fail.
